All-solid-state reflection-controllable electrochromic device and optical switchable component using it

1. An all-solid-state reflection-controllable electrochromic device, comprising a reflection-controllable device having a multilayer thin film formed on a transparent base material, the multilayer thin film comprising, at least a transparent conductive film layer, an ion storage layer, a solid electrolyte layer, a catalyst layer and a reflection-controllable layer comprising a magnesium-nickel based alloy thin film formed on the base material.
